Top 5 Dynamic Games on Android in the Middle East: Q2 2025
Explore the performance of the top five dynamic games on the Android platform in the Middle East during Q2 2025, including insights on down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the second quarter of 2025, the Android gaming landscape in the Middle East saw significant movement among the top-performing dynamic games. Based on data from Sensor Tower, here’s a closer look at how these games performed in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
Roblox from Roblox Corporation maintained a strong presence, with weekly revenue reaching nearly $398K by the end of June. Downloads showed a consistent upward trend, peaking at around 162K in the last week of the quarter. Active users also increased steadily, growing from approximately 2.9M to 3.6M.
EA SPORTS FC™ Mobile Soccer, by ELECTRONIC ARTS, saw weekly revenue rise to about $73K in early June before settling at $41K by month-end. Downloads were stable, with figures around 42K in the last week, while active users fluctuated, peaking at over 1M in early May before ending the quarter at approximately 923K.
Gossip Harbor: Merge & Story from Microfun Limited experienced a notable increase in weekly revenue, reaching about $70K in late June. Downloads varied throughout the quarter, culminating in nearly 9.7K in the final week. The app's active user base expanded from around 91K to 126K.
Evony: The King's Return by TG Inc. saw weekly revenue peak at approximately $66K in late May. Downloads were lower, with a high of around 16K at the start of the quarter. Active users hovered around 20K to 28K, with some fluctuations.
Gardenscapes, developed by Playrix, maintained steady weekly revenue, averaging around $43K. Downloads were relatively stable, ending at about 6.6K, while active users increased from 54K to 52K over the quarter.
